private static int CalculateHP(Pokemon pokemon) { // HP = // (floor((2 * Base + IV + floor(EV / 4)) * Level) + Level + 10) int baseHP = pokemon.BaseStats.HP; int IVHP = pokemon.IVs.HP; int level = pokemon.Level; int EVHP = pokemon.EVs.HP; return (int)(Floor(((2 * baseHP + IVHP + Floor((double)EVHP / 4)) * level) / 100) + level + 10); }
private static int InternalCalculateStat(Pokemon pokemon, PokemonStatType statType) { // Stat = // floor((floor(((2 * base + IV + floor(EV / 4)) * level) / 100) + 5) * nature) int IV = pokemon.EVs.GetStat(statType); int EV = pokemon.IVs.GetStat(statType); int baseStat = pokemon.BaseStats.GetStat(statType); double nature = 1.0d; if (pokemon.Nature.StatIncrease.Contains(statType)) nature = 1.1d; else if (pokemon.Nature.StatDecrease.Contains(statType)) nature = 0.9d; return (int)((Floor((Floor(2 * baseStat + IV + Floor((double)EV / 4)) * pokemon.Level) / 100) + 5) * nature); }
/// <summary> /// Returns a specific stat for a Pokémon. /// </summary> public static int CalculateStat(Pokemon pokemon, PokemonStatType statType) { return statType == PokemonStatType.HP ? CalculateHP(pokemon) : InternalCalculateStat(pokemon, statType); }
